The Challenge: Why High‑Mix Factories Need More Than Just Machines

Electronics manufacturing service (EMS) factories producing smartphone motherboards, LED modules, or automotive ECUs face frequent product changeovers. Integrating equipment from different vendors often leads to compatibility issues, inconsistent throughput, and longer troubleshooting times. A turnkey solution that includes line design, equipment matching, and preshipment testing can reduce these risks. Motek’s SMT turnkey solution covers the entire process chain. Core equipment includes the Hanwha Decan S2 pick‑and‑place machine with a speed of 92,000 CPH and placement accuracy of ±28 μm, the XMR‑800D reflow oven with 8 top/8 bottom heating zones, and the HMH830D automatic online glue dispenser. The line can be supplemented with PCB loaders/unloaders, buffer conveyors, depaneling routers, cleaning machines, feeders (8 mm, 12 mm, 24 mm), and nozzles compatible with Fuji, Yamaha, and JUKI heads.
